Facing an insurance dispute can be stressful. It often involves complex procedures and legalese that can leave you feeling overwhelmed. However, by following a clear step-by-step guide, you can successfully navigate this process and increase your chances of a favorable outcome.
- Initially, carefully review your insurance policy documents to understand your benefits. Identify the specific terms that pertain to your dispute and any relevant restrictions.
- Subsequently, gather all essential documentation, including medical records, invoices, and correspondence with the insurance company.
- Carefully document every interaction you have with the insurance company, noting dates, times, names of representatives, and the substance of conversations. This log will be invaluable if your dispute progresses to a higher level.
- Furthermore, consider speaking with an insurance attorney or advocate. They can provide expert guidance on your rights and options, and help you develop a strong case.
Remember, determination is key when dealing with insurance disputes. Continue organized, keep detailed records, and advocate for your rights.
Winning Your Insurance Claim: Strategies for Success
Submitting an insurance claim can feel like a daunting task, however with the right strategies, you can maximize your chances of a successful outcome. First and foremost, carefully review your policy documents to comprehend your coverage limits and any specific requirements for filing a claim. Next, rapidly report the incident to your insurer, providing them with all required details in a clear and concise manner. Assemble evidence to support your claim, such as photographs, repair estimates, or witness statements.
Across the claims process, maintain open communication with your adjuster, answering their inquiries promptly and truthfully. Be prepared to discuss the settlement amount if you believe it is inadequate. Remember, patience and persistence are key to securing your claim successfully.

Don't Settle for Less: Fighting Back Against Unfair Insurance Practices
You deserve quality insurance coverage that satisfies your needs. Unfortunately, the insurance industry can sometimes feel like a labyrinth of complex practices. When you encounter unfair treatment or dubious tactics from your insurer, don't remain silent. Fight back!
Insurance companies have a responsibility to act ethically and honestly. They should provide clear policies, process claims promptly, and treat you with dignity. If your insurer falls short of these standards, remember that you have rights.
* **Review Your Policy:** Carefully scrutinize your insurance document to verify you understand its terms and conditions.
* **Document Everything:** Keep a detailed record of all communication with your insurer, including dates, times, names, and summaries.
* **Seek External Assistance:** If you encounter difficulties resolving the issue directly with your insurer, consider speaking with a consumer protection agency or an insurance ombudsman. They can provide support and help you explore your options.
Don't let unfair insurance practices slide by. Equip yourself with knowledge and take the necessary steps to protect your rights. Remember, you have the power to make a difference.
